Transcriptome of the liver tissue from Hyal1-knock out mice
Ontology highlight
ABSTRACT: Hyaluronidase-1 (Hyal1) is a lysosomal hyaluronidase that intracellularly hydrolyzes hyaluronan. The analysis of Hyal1's roles in hepatic gluconeogenesis from standard and obese conditions benefits from a model organism with Hyal1 deletion. Here, RNA-seq data of liver tissue from wild-type or Hyal1 knock-out mice fed with a low-fat or high-fat diet for 14 weeks.
